Crystalline phosphorus fibers: controllable synthesis and visible-light-driven photocatalytic activity

Abstract: An efficient method is developed for the synthesis of single crystalline fibrous phosphorus submicron materials. Via the chemical vapor deposition (CVD) technique, fibrous phosphorus fibers with diameters from ∼150 nm to 2 μm were prepared directly from amorphous red phosphorus. The as-prepared fibrous phosphorus exhibited interesting photocatalytic properties.

“…In Figure D, the cross‐sectional view of Ti‐RP/ZnO by field‐emission scanning electron microscopy (FE‐SEM) exhibits an average thickness of ≈1.55 µm. As shown in Figure E,E1, high‐resolution transmission electron microscopy (HRTEM) images of the RP film display the morphology of the nanosheet, clearly showing parallel lattice fringes of (001) facets with a d‐spacing of 5.81 Å, which is consistent with typical fibrous P . Furthermore, the Raman spectra (Figure S3, Supporting Information) between 300 and 500 cm −1 of amorphous RP and Ti‐RP further confirm the successful growth of RP on Ti, as Ti‐RP exhibits the peaks of fibrous RP .…”

“…First‐principles density functional theory revealed that the effective masses of both electrons and holes in single‐layered Hittorf's phosphorus (HP) had a strong anisotropy along x and y directions . It was also experimentally demonstrated that single‐crystalline fibrous phosphorus grown along the long axis of fibers via chemical vapor deposition (CVD) exhibited higher photocatalytic degradation activity than amorphous RP nanoparticles . However, to date, there are rare experimental results about the effect of crystallographic orientation on the phosphorus‐based photocatalysts for water splitting, with the mechanisms of performance improvement remaining unclear.…”
